【发布时间】:2014-11-06 14:47:33
【问题描述】:
我正在尝试使用这个 Foundation 插件:http://foundation.zurb.com/docs/components/equalizer.html
这是我的代码:
<div class="row" data-equalizer>
<div class="large-4 medium-6 small-12 columns" data-equalizer-watch>
{some content}
</div>
<div class="large-4 medium-6 small-12 columns" data-equalizer-watch>
{some content}
</div>
<div class="large-4 medium-6 small-12 columns" data-equalizer-watch>
{some content}
</div>
</div>
然后我在正文末尾添加了以下脚本:
<script src="js/foundation.min.js"></script>
<script src="js/foundation/foundation.reveal.js"></script>
<script src="js/foundation/foundation.datepicker.js"></script>
<script src="js/foundation/foundation.dropdown.js"></script>
<script src="js/foundation/foundation.equalizer.js"></script>
<script>
$(document).foundation();
</script>
</body>
问题只是均衡器不起作用。
所有 .js 都正确加载(没有 404 错误),并且 Javascript 控制台没有抛出任何类型的错误。 一切对我来说似乎都很好,我错在哪里? 谢谢各位。
【问题讨论】:
-
我没有立即看到任何错误。这只是一个 html/css/js 网站,还是该网站内置于 CMS 中,可能会导致一些缓存问题?
-
我已经将代码复制到一个页面中,除此之外没有任何其他内容。它不工作。
-
你的 html 很好,你可以在这里看到:codepen.io/anon/pen/Ffxly
-
可能是你包含了foundation.min.js,它里面有foundation.equalizer.js。因此,您通过单独添加插件来包含均衡器功能两次。
标签: javascript zurb-foundation